Fatty foods are much worse for anyone who suffers from acid reflux than healthier options. Fatty foods can cause your esophageal sphincter to relax, letting acid flow upwards. Fatty foods also cause weight gain. People who are overweight tend to suffer from acid reflux. Eat better and feel better!

Exercising after eating can be a disaster if you’re suffering from acid reflux. Food in the stomach may be forced into the esophagus when the lower abdominal muscles are contracting during an exercise routine. Don’t engage in vigorous exercise for at least an hour after eating.

Pregnant women are also subject to acid reflux. The baby can push acid back into the esophagus. You can keep your symptoms under control by eating foods low in fat and acid. You could also enjoy gentle herb teas which help to neutralize the acids in your stomach.

Reflux can sometimes be extremely painful. Occasionally, it may feel like a heart attack. If you are suffering from serious chest pain, don’t ignore it. There is a chance that a heart attack is occurring. Call a medical assistance line in order to get help determining the source of your pain. You don’t need serious health issues because of a wrong self-diagnosis.

You can raise your bed with bricks or a piece of wood. The head of your bed should be approximately six inches higher. You can stop stomach acid from rising into your esophagus by elevating your chest and head.

Slippery elm lozenges are a good natural remedy to try. The active ingredient in this product helps to form a protective coating on your esophagus.This lozenge also works to prevent the cough that often accompany acid reflux. You should be able to find this product at most health food stores.

Losing weight can decrease your acid reflux symptoms. Obesity is one of the most common contributing factors to acid reflux symptoms. Just losing a small amount of weight can help. Weight loss ought to be achieved through small meals, not through crash diets.

Stay away from alcohol if you need to get rid of acid reflux. Alcohol causes stomach acid to build and can also deteriorate the lining of the stomach, leading to acid reflux. Avoid beverages when you have frequent acid reflux risk. Drinking liquids with a meal will increase the volume of food in your stomach contents. This creates more pressure on your esophagus and causes an increased risk of reflux. Drink between meals instead of during them to avoid this.

Try to eliminate stress caused by work, school or relationship issues. Stress increases stomach acid which increases inflammation and heartburn. When you know what is upsetting you and causing stress, you can take steps to remove it.
